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Worcestershire Parkway to Knutsford start from as little as £30.80

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Worcestershire Parkway to Knutsford are available for £72.40 one way, or £144.70 return

Everything you need to know about Worcestershire Parkway Station

Discover Worcestershire Parkway Train Station

Nestled in the heart of England, Worcestershire Parkway Train Station serves as a pivotal transport hub in the West Midlands. Opened relatively recently in February 2020, this modern station was designed to ease transport connectivity within the northwest-southeast mainline axis and improve access to rail services for the surrounding county. With its strategic location and excellent facilities, Worcestershire Parkway is an ideal choice for local commuters and travelers bound for various destinations across the UK.

Facilities and Amenities at Worcestershire Parkway

When you step into Worcestershire Parkway, you'll immediately notice its focus on accessibility and convenience. The station features step-free access throughout, ensuring it is welcoming to all travelers. Ticketing options are flexible, offering both a staffed ticket office and user-friendly machines, including accessible ones. Although waiting room facilities are absent, there is ample seating available for a comfortable wait.

Additional services include helpful staff at the ticket office and customer help points, who are ready to assist from early morning till late evening. CCTV coverage assures safety, while free parking for blue badge holders emphasizes inclusive services. For cyclists, there are 52 cycling spaces equipped with CCTV, ensuring security for those commuting on two wheels.

Onward Travel Options

Worcestershire Parkway is a gateway to seamless travel, with excellent integration with other modes of transportation. A bus stop and a taxi stand right at the station's front ease your onward journey. If you're planning a trip further afield, consider the X50 bus route, connecting Worcester to Evesham via Pershore - a perfect day trip opportunity.

Everything you need to know about Knutsford Station

Welcome to Knutsford Train Station

Located in Cheshire, Knutsford Train Station is more than just a stop on the map—it's a gateway to both local adventures and broader journeys. Station Amenities and Facilities

When visiting Knutsford Train Station, you'll find several essential amenities to assist with your journey. The station operates a well-timed ticket office that opens early and closes late: Monday to Friday from 06:30 to 20:30, Saturday from 07:00 to 19:30, and Sunday from 12:10 to 19:40. For convenience, there are ticket machines available, including accessible ones, as well as facilities to collect tickets purchased online. Accessibility features are integrated into the station’s layout. Designated as a Category B Station, there is step-free access to some areas, with separate level entrances for platforms heading towards Chester and Manchester.

If you require additional support, staff assistance is available from Monday, 06:30 to 20:00. Additionally, there is an induction loop for the hearing impaired, and a ramp is available for train access. While there are no waiting rooms, passengers can find ample seating areas on the platforms.

Connectivity and Transport Links

Moving beyond the station, Knutsford provides multiple onward travel options. If your journey requires rail replacement services, pick-up and drop-off points are conveniently located at bus stops on Adams Hill. For those seeking local taxi services, details are accessible via Northern Railway's taxi information page. Buses are also a viable option, with connections available through Traveline at 0871 200 2233. Cyclists would need to look elsewhere for bicycle hire as this facility is not available at the station.
